Hello Weily_li,
Regarding the 'get_timing_info' - please check {eIQ_Toolkit_Install|\docs\DeepViewRT_User_Manual.pdf -> A.2 ModelClient
Returns:
put_time: the timing information regarding how long it took to send the most recent rtm to the modelrunner application post_time: the total time to run the model (includes the post request and evaluation) eval_time: the time it took for the modelrunner application to run the model.
